In re Mitchell, Marvin; applying for writ of certiorari and/or review, writs of prohibition, mandamus and stay order; Parish of Ouachita, 4th Judicial District Court, Div. “B”, No. 43641; to the Court of Appeal, Second Circuit, No. 17812-KW.
Granted. The trial judge is ordered to appoint a Sanity Commission to determine the ability to understand the nature of this proceeding and to assist counsel in the preparation and conduct of his defense.
